EHOVE's has created new programs to meet the workforce demands of our local employers and economy.   In Adult Education,  Building Trades  has joined 18 other occupational program offerings.  This new, full time program teaches students construction drawings, material handling, residential electricity, construction framing (floors, walls, roofs, stairs), drywall installation, drywall finishing, residential plumbing, and residential HVAC. 

In the high school, two new programs, called Manufacturing Design & Robotics and Welding & Fabrication, will complete a roster of 25 total career tech choices for students in the 2024-2025 school year.

Manufacturing Design & Robotics will teach students how to design and create 3D models, program industrial robots, and how to use CAD and CAM software, 3D printers, CNC and manual machine tools.  Welding & Fabrication will teach students how to utilize the four major welding techniques and fabricate metal, oxyfuel and plasma arc cutting, CNC press brake and CNC plasma table.
